First of all, TMT has gone through continual big changes. Not sure if that's over yet. Lots of San Fran bankers have left over time. Much of the old TMT group used to be Hambrecht & Quist, a San Fran IB bought by Chase. Eventually the culture (and control) of the JPMorgan crew kind of overran the old H&Q. The Tech piece of TMT basically has a different business model than other the other non-tech IB sectors and this has been a constant problem.
I can't speak accurately to how life in JPM's TMT compares to the various other TMT groups on the street. But, I would guess that there are better IB sector coverage teams in JPM to join than TMT.
I wouldn't believe anything that says analysts or interns in New York don't work weekends. Expect 80-90 hour weeks, 6 or 7 days. |
